Proof of No Edit: Bobby Gray with Real Infinite Crypto

An unscripted live conversation between Bobby Gray and YouTuber Brad of Real Infinite Crypto — two eras of the TXC community, why the mine alone doesn't make your coins valuable, the exchange-of-value spectrum before and after the cease-and-desist, and why network marketing is coming back.

Two very different entry points

Bobby opened with an observation about the TEXITcoin community: the people who joined on the dirt road in McKinney in April 2024 joined for entirely different reasons than the people who joined a year later. The early crowd bought into a mission with no exchanges, no working tooling, barely a network — just an idea and a founder with a track record in alternative currency. The later crowd bought into momentum: the chart, the wrapped supercars, the hot air balloon, 165 people flown across the world to Bangkok and Singapore.

Neither is wrong. But the difference matters, because when the momentum stopped, the mission had to carry the weight.

Mine, trade, spend — and build

Brad's path into TXC came through network marketing and a lifelong allergy to trading time for dollars. That led into one of the strongest segments of the conversation: the difference between an asset that pays you and an asset you actually have to steward.

The mine gives you the reward. It does not make the reward valuable. That part is on the community — building on the chain, moving coins, paying gas, onboarding merchants, learning custody. Bobby noted the mempool going from one transaction at a time to steady multi-transaction blocks as builders show up. The old billboard slogan needs a fourth word: mine, trade, spend, build.

The exchange-of-value spectrum

The most candid stretch covered the referral program. It started at one extreme — the "magic money plan," where people collected thousands a week without doing much of anything. Rules came later, and the model drifted toward the middle: you do something, we do something. Then the February 11 cease-and-desist arrived and everything stopped, unilaterally, everywhere — not just in Texas — out of caution and the honest admission that nobody yet knew exactly what the objection was.

That swung the pendulum to the far other end: pure mission. Not a paycheck this month, but something that matters for the next generation. Hundreds of people who had gone full-time went to zero overnight. The ask was simple and hard: stick with me, because honest money is real.

On ColdCard, and not giving up

Asked for a comment on the ColdCard entropy failure that drained hundreds of millions across the industry, Bobby threw out the boilerplate his PR team drafted. The message he wanted on record instead: don't turn back. This industry has scams, it has bad actors, and sometimes it just has people making a bad mistake. Evaluate quickly which one you're looking at — then keep going, carefully, because the future depends on getting honest money right.

Brad's addition: a person can endure almost anything with a little hope. Get started, never quit, and somewhere in between you figure it out. Bobby closed on a Michael J. Fox line he keeps handy — with gratitude, optimism is sustainable.

Network marketing is coming back

The conversation ended where it started, on community. MLM is a dirty word, and Bobby's answer is that he isn't apologizing for building an incentive for people to share the story. It was shut down in February out of caution. It is coming back — because nothing else brings a community together the way it does, and the corporate ladder certainly doesn't.
